VMC Provider of the Month

Congratulations to Dr. Michele Despreaux, Valley’s May 2019 Provider of the Month. Dr. Despreaux works in Valley’s Senior and Internal Medicine Clinic. This story was relayed to the nominator from a patient’s wife:

“A patient of Dr. Despreaux’s was too tired to walk back to the car himself after an appointment. Dr. Despreaux took the time to personally ‘wheel’ him from the clinic to their car. The patient’s wife was blown away that a doctor would do that, and was very impressed by Dr. Despreaux’s dedication and thoughtfulness.”

Thank you, Dr. Despreaux, for your professionalism, accountability, and commitment to your patients!

Jan Carlton, MD, a much-respected Valley Family Medicine Residency Program faculty physician, will retire at the end of June. One of the original faculty physicians from the opening of the family medicine residency program in 1986, Dr. Carlton currently oversees a critical part of the residency curriculum which focuses on teaching family medicine residents how to maintain well-being and resilience as practicing physicians during and after residency.

Dr. Carlton's VFM faculty colleague says, "Jan has always encouraged me to be more than that person defined by my professional roles. She gently encourages growth in all areas of life. As she has flourished in her artistic endeavors, she has encouraged me in my writing. Jan brings her whole self to teaching and to medicine and she encourages others to do the same. She has as much compassion for her learners as she does for her patients."

During her career, Dr. Carlton briefly left Valley to teach in Olympia, returning to VFM as a faculty physician with the residency for the last 20 years and serving as an associate professor of family medicine at the UW School of Medicine's Department of Family Medicine.

Dr. Carlton also co-directs the resident Balint curriculum, nurturing a more therapeutic alliance between clinician and patient through a group process of exploration. Medical participants work toward transforming uncertainty and difficulty in the doctor-patient relationship into greater understanding and meaning.

Dr. Carlton is a talented watercolor artist and in retirement plans to spend more time in this endeavor
